Instruments: Trumpet
For beginning students I usually start with the Standards of Excellence series of method books. Once the student has grasped the fundamentals of playing, I will introduce solo repertoire students can begin working on to explore aspects of playing such as expression, tuning, phrasing, and different articulations. I use chorales to work on breathing, phrasing, and dynamics. For intermediate and advanced students, I will ask what they feel they need to work on to help guide my instruction. Read More

Instruments: Guitar Bass Guitar Banjo Ukulele Mandolin
For beginners I press through Hal Leonard's Guitar Method #1, laying a foundation of skills as well as approaching notation reading on the guitar. From there we begin to specialize based on the student's interest. For more advanced students, we'll focus on goals such as live performances, audition preparation, and repertoire. Read More
